I have my Contacts organised in several folders in Outlook 2003. I've gone in
to each folder and the contacts I want to send a christmas card to I've entered "Xmas Card" in the category field. However, when I mail merge to word to create address labels I can only do so from within each contacts folder. I would like to find a way to create a set of all the contacts in the category Xmas Card and then mail merge those to Word. Can anyone help? |

Either perform multiple merges or copy all the items into a new contacts folder you create just for this merge.
